I celebrated my 40th birthday with a trip to New Orleans and it was a super fun location for a trip with the girls. We stayed for four nights which was enough to enjoy the sights and the amazing music.
The journey
We flew from London to New Orleans with British Airways. It’s a 10 hour flight, and the time difference was a bit of a shock to the system. On arrival we took a taxi to our hotel, we didn’t book in advance as there is a taxi rank at the airport and the prices are fixed.
Where we stayed
We stayed at the Virgin Hotel New Orleans and it was so good. The bar was great and the rooms were so luxurious with the most comfortable beds ever. We shared rooms with two queen beds so everyone had their own space.
How we spent our time
New Orleans is famous for its music. The first night we stayed in the hotel as it was late by the time we arrived. The second night we didn’t really know what we were doing and ended up at the Hotel Monteleone which was in the French Quarter which is known for having the best nightlife. It was a very American hotel famous for its Carousel bar, but we struck lucky as there was a great live band and we had a good time.
On the third night we knew what we were doing and headed to Frenchmen Street which had such a good ambience with a great street band and lots of amazing music. We spent most of the evening in The Spotted Cat and again there was an amazing band playing and we had a great time. The last night we went to Snug Harbour to see Trumpet Mafia which was a very different experience, sitting down listening to more high brow jazz – it was very good but not as fun.
During the day we explored the city including going on the Steamboat Nachez cruise down the Mississippi which had such awful cocktails it was hilarious – definitely don’t eat on the boat! We also did a lot of shopping on Magazine Street.
